Contenido breve

Los protocolos de Capa 0 son esencialmente la infraestructura sobre la cual se pueden construir las cadenas de bloques de Capa 1. Como capa base para las redes y aplicaciones de cadenas de bloques, los protocolos de Capa 0 son parte de muchas soluciones para abordar los desafíos que enfrenta la industria, como la escalabilidad y la compatibilidad. 

Introducción

¿En qué consiste el ecosistema blockchain? Una forma de categorizar las diferentes partes de dicho ecosistema es clasificarlas en capas como si fueran protocolos de Internet.

El ecosistema blockchain se puede clasificar según los siguientes niveles: 

Capa 0: la infraestructura base sobre la cual se pueden construir múltiples cadenas de bloques de Capa 1.

Capa 1: las cadenas de bloques subyacentes utilizadas por los desarrolladores para crear aplicaciones descentralizadas (dApps).

Capa 2: Soluciones de escalamiento que manejan actividades fuera de las cadenas de bloques de Capa 1 para aligerar su carga transaccional.

Capa 3: aplicaciones Blockchain, incluidos juegos, billeteras y otras dApps.

Sin embargo, no todos los ecosistemas blockchain entran en estas categorías. Algunos ecosistemas pueden no tener niveles, mientras que otros pueden clasificarse en diferentes niveles según el contexto. 

Los protocolos de capa 0 ayudan a resolver los problemas que enfrentan las redes de capa 1 construidas con una arquitectura monolítica, como Ethereum. Al crear una infraestructura subyacente más flexible y permitir a los desarrolladores ejecutar sus propias cadenas de bloques para fines específicos, la Capa 0 pretende abordar de forma más eficaz cuestiones como la escalabilidad y la interoperabilidad. 

¿Qué problemas puede resolver el nivel 0?

Compatibilidad

La interoperabilidad se refiere a la capacidad de las redes blockchain para interactuar entre sí. Esta propiedad permite una red más estrechamente entrelazada de productos y servicios habilitados para blockchain, lo que a su vez proporciona una mejor experiencia de usuario. 

Las redes blockchain construidas sobre el mismo protocolo de capa 0 pueden comunicarse entre sí sin necesidad de puentes especiales. Utilizando varias iteraciones de protocolos de transferencia entre cadenas, la Capa 0 permite que las cadenas de bloques del ecosistema creen características y casos de uso entre sí. Los resultados de esto son una mayor velocidad y eficiencia de las transacciones.

Escalabilidad 

Una cadena de bloques monolítica como Ethereum a menudo está sobrecargada porque un protocolo de capa 1 única proporciona todas las funciones críticas, como la ejecución de transacciones, el consenso y la disponibilidad de datos. Esto crea desafíos para la escalabilidad, que la Capa 0 puede aliviar delegando estas funciones críticas a otras cadenas de bloques. 

Este diseño garantiza que las redes blockchain construidas sobre la misma infraestructura de capa 0 puedan optimizar determinadas tareas, aumentando así la escalabilidad. Por ejemplo, las cadenas de ejecución se pueden optimizar para manejar una gran cantidad de transacciones por segundo. 

Flexibilidad para el desarrollador

Para alentar a los desarrolladores a usarlos, los protocolos de Capa 0 a menudo proporcionan kits de desarrollo de software (SDK) fáciles de usar y una interfaz simple, lo que garantiza que los desarrolladores puedan ejecutar fácilmente sus propias cadenas de bloques para propósitos específicos. 

Los protocolos de capa 0 brindan a los desarrolladores más flexibilidad para personalizar sus propias cadenas de bloques, permitiéndoles definir sus propios modelos de emisión de tokens y controlar el tipo de dApps que desean construir en sus cadenas de bloques.

¿Cómo funciona el protocolo de capa 0?

Existen diferentes métodos para trabajar con protocolos de Capa 0, cada uno de ellos tiene su propio diseño, características y enfoques.

Pero, en general, los protocolos de capa 0 sirven como cadena de bloques principal y primaria, respaldando los datos de las transacciones de diferentes cadenas de capa 1. Si bien hay grupos de cadenas de capa 1 construidas sobre los protocolos de capa 0, también existen protocolos de transferencia entre cadenas que permiten. Transferencias de tokens y datos desde diferentes blockchains. 

Las estructuras y relaciones de estos tres componentes pueden variar de un protocolo de Capa 0 a otro. Aquí consideraremos varios ejemplos: 

Lunares

El cofundador de Ethereum, Gavin Wood, diseñó Polkadot para permitir a los desarrolladores construir sus propias cadenas de bloques. El protocolo utiliza una cadena principal (mainchain) llamada Polkadot Relay Chain, y cada blockchain independiente construida sobre Polkadot se conoce como cadena paralela o parachain.

Relay Chain funciona como un puente entre paracaídas para garantizar una transferencia de datos eficiente. Utiliza fragmentación, un método para dividir cadenas de bloques u otros tipos de bases de datos, para hacer que el proceso de procesamiento de transacciones sea más eficiente.

Polkadot utiliza la verificación de prueba de participación (PoS) para garantizar la seguridad y el consenso de la red. Los proyectos que quieran utilizar Polkadot participan en subastas de espacios. El primer proyecto de parachain de Polkadot fue aprobado en una subasta en diciembre de 2021.

avalancha

Avalanche, lanzado en 2020 por Ava Labs con un enfoque en protocolos DeFi, utiliza una infraestructura que consta de tres cadenas principales: cadena de contrato (cadena C), cadena de intercambio (cadena X) y cadena de plataforma (cadena P).

Estas tres cadenas están configuradas específicamente para realizar funciones esenciales en el ecosistema para mejorar la seguridad, mantener una baja latencia y un alto rendimiento. X-Chain se utiliza para crear e intercambiar activos, C-Chain para crear contratos inteligentes y P-Chain para coordinar validadores y subredes. La estructura flexible de Avalanche también permite intercambios entre cadenas rápidos y económicos.  

Cosmos

Fundada en 2014 por Ethan Buchman y Jay Kwon, la red Cosmos consta de una red blockchain PoS central llamada Cosmos Hub y blockchains personalizadas conocidas como Zones. Cosmos Hub transfiere activos y datos entre zonas conectadas y proporciona un nivel general de seguridad. 

Cada Zona es altamente personalizable, lo que permite a los desarrolladores crear su propia criptomoneda con su propio sistema de verificación de bloques y otras funciones. Todas las aplicaciones y servicios de Cosmos alojados en estas Zonas interactúan a través del protocolo de Comunicación Inter-Blockchain (IBC). Esto permite que los activos y los datos se intercambien libremente a través de cadenas de bloques independientes.

Resultados

Dependiendo de cómo estén diseñadas, las cadenas de bloques de Nivel 0 podrían potencialmente resolver algunos de los desafíos de la industria, como la interoperabilidad y la escalabilidad. Sin embargo, queda por ver qué tan exitosa será la adopción de la cadena de bloques de nivel 0. Hay muchas soluciones competitivas que apuntan a lograr objetivos similares.

La importancia que tendrán las cadenas de bloques de nivel 0 para resolver los desafíos de la industria dependerá de su capacidad para atraer desarrolladores para crear estos protocolos y de si las aplicaciones alojadas en ellas brindan un valor real a los usuarios. 

Artículos relacionados

  • ¿Qué es el Nivel 1 en Blockchain?

  • Soluciones de escalabilidad de capa 1 y capa 2 de Blockchain

  • ¿Qué es el trilema blockchain?